Aditya Thackeray to visit Pune ahead of civic polls on Feb 6-7

Pune : NpNews24 Online All parties are preparing for the upcoming civic polls after draft ward structures of various municipal corporations were announced on Tuesday. In this backdrop, State Environment Minister Aditya Thackeray will be on a two-day tour of Pune on February 6-7.

 

Thackeray will inaugurate various projects and hold meetings with party leaders in the city.

 

Strategy for the impending civic polls

All parties have announced that they would fight the civic polls independently. Though the constituents of Mahavikas Aghadi are together at the state level, they are ready to go alone in the municipal elections. Aditya Thackeray will be visiting Pune on Sunday and Monday. During his visit, he will inaugurate various projects and hold meetings with party office-bearers to plan for the elections. This was revealed by Shiv Sena Pune unit chief Sanjay More.

 

Decision about alliance will be made by the party leaders

The Shiv Sena has been preparing to contest alone in the civic polls in Pune for the past two years by conducting Shiv Sampark Abhiyan (contact drives), Shiv Samvad (interactions with citizens) programme. Efforts have been made to expand the party base in the city. “The decision about the alliance will be made by the party leaders, CM Uddhav Thackeray, Aditya Thackeray and Sanjay Raut. However, we are ready to fight on our own,” said Sanjay More.
